Tasmania experienced high renewable penetration of 86.8% during the 15 September 2026 morning period, with wind and hydro generation collectively dominating the generation mix. Regional reference prices showed extreme volatility, declining to negative territory before sharply rising to over $71/MWh within 25 minutes, reflecting rapid swings in system dynamics.
The price spike from near-zero to $71.52/MWh correlates with binding constraints on multiple regulation service requirements (F_TASCAP_RREG_0220 and F_T+RREG_0050), each carrying marginal values between $4.91 and $7.79/MWh. High renewable penetration typically reduces synchronous inertia and reactive power support, elevating the cost and scarcity of regulation services required to maintain system stability, which appears reflected in the escalating constraint marginal values and corresponding RRP increases.
